Sio Partners lost 12.1% net for June, compared to the S&P 500’s 2.3% gain, the MSCI World Healthcare Index’s 2.9% return and the 1.4% return for the MSCI World Index. Sio’s long positions subtracted 5.9% during June, while its shorts subtracted 8.2% from its performance. Q2 2021 hedge fund letters, conferences and more In his July letter to investors, which was reviewed by ValueWalk, Michael Castor of Sio Capital said June was a disappointing month and the single worst month in the fund’s 16-year history.
